117.info
人生若只如初见

linux服务器日志乱码怎么解决

如果在Linux服务器上查看日志文件时出现乱码,可能是因为日志文件的编码格式与查看工具的编码格式不一致导致的。以下是一些解决方法:

  1. 使用正确的命令查看日志文件:在查看日志文件时,使用正确的命令来查看,例如使用catless命令来查看文本文件。

  2. 指定编码格式:如果日志文件是使用UTF-8编码的,可以使用-U选项来指定编码格式,例如cat -U logfile

  3. 使用工具转换编码格式:可以使用工具如iconv来将日志文件的编码格式转换为正确的格式,例如iconv -f GBK -t UTF-8 logfile > new_logfile

  4. 检查系统编码设置:确保系统的编码设置与日志文件的编码格式一致,可以通过locale命令来查看系统的编码设置。

  5. 使用其他工具查看日志文件:如果以上方法都无效,可以尝试使用其他工具来查看日志文件,例如使用文本编辑器如vimgedit来查看。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e387AzsICQNUBVY.html

推荐文章

  • linux chmod删除权限怎么做

    在Linux中,要删除一个文件的权限,您可以使用chmod命令来更改文件的模式
    chmod -x filename 这将删除文件上的执行权限。您可以将filename替换为您要修改权...

  • linux chmod怎样赋予全部权限

    在Linux中,使用chmod命令可以更改文件或目录的权限
    chmod 777 filename 这将给予文件所有者、组和其他用户读、写和执行(rwx)的权限。如果你想对目录进行...

  • linux chmod数字模式怎么设

    在Linux中,chmod命令用于更改文件或目录的权限 首先,你需要知道每个权限代表的含义: 读(r):4
    写(w):2
    执行(x):1 然后,根据需要为文件或目...

  • linux chmod符号模式如何用

    chmod(change mode)是一个用于修改文件或目录权限的命令 基本语法: chmod [选项] 模式[,模式]... 文件名或目录名 符号模式:
    符号模式是由一个或多个字符...

  • linux服务器日志如何查看

    要查看Linux服务器上的日志,可以使用以下方法: 使用命令行工具查看日志文件: 使用cat命令查看日志文件的内容,例如:cat /var/log/messages。
    使用less或...

  • Java怎么读取txt文件中的内容

    要读取一个txt文件中的内容,可以使用Java中的File类和Scanner类。下面是一个简单的示例代码:
    import java.io.File;
    import java.io.FileNotFoundExc...

  • java读取文件内容的方法是什么

    在Java中,读取文件内容的方法可以通过使用Java IO(Input/Output)类来实现。其中常用的类包括File、FileInputStream、BufferedReader等。以下是读取文件内容的...

  • java如何修改json中的value值

    在 Java 中修改 JSON 中的值可以通过使用 JSON 库来实现。以下是一个简单的示例代码,说明如何修改 JSON 中的值:
    import org.json.JSONObject; public cla...